Nourished by Nic

  • Recipes
    • Breakfast
    • Snacks
    • Dinner
    • Appetizers + Sides
    • Dessert
  • Lifestyle
  • Work with me
  • About
    • Privacy Policy
  • Shop
menu icon
go to homepage
  • Recipes
  • Lifestyle
  • Shop
  • About
  • Contact
    • Email
    • Instagram
    • Pinterest
    • Substack
    • TikTok
    • YouTube
  • subscribe
    search icon
    Homepage link
    • Recipes
    • Lifestyle
    • Shop
    • About
    • Contact
    • Email
    • Instagram
    • Pinterest
    • Substack
    • TikTok
    • YouTube
  • ×
    Home » Recipes » Salads

    Thai Chopped Salad (Meal Prep Friendly)

    Published: Mar 4, 2023 · Modified: Mar 23, 2025 by Nicole Addison · This post may contain affiliate links · 28 Comments

    ↓ Jump to Recipe
    Pin the Recipe

    Packed with colorful veggies and a tangy sesame ginger lime dressing, this Thai chopped salad is the best balanced recipe that's also meal prep friendly!

    Serving Thai chopped salad in bowls.

    Thai food is one of my favourite cuisines to explore in Toronto. I love exploring other cultures through their traditional foods, and Thailand is no exception! This Thai chopped salad is in no way traditional, but a delicious salad inspired by Thai flavour. It's crunchy, colorful, and balanced with carbs, plant-based protein and healthy fats. Tossed with the best tangy sesame ginger lime dressing, it's a salad you'll crave!

    The best part about this Thai chopped salad is that it's meal prep friendly. Salads are such an easy packed lunch, but it's always disappointing when they get soggy by noon. That won't happen here! Thanks to our base of cruciferous veggies and sturdy kale, this salad actually tastes even better the longer it marinates in the dressing. You'll be looking forward to lunch all morning!

    Ingredients

    Ingredients for Thai chopped salad on a tray including quinoa, cabbage, kale and more.
    Ingredients for sesame ginger lime dressing including vinegar, honey, olive oil and sesame oil.

    Salad base:

    • White quinoa
    • Shelled edamame
    • Purple cabbage
    • Carrots
    • Curly kale
    • Cucumber

    Optional flavour boosters:

    • Cilantro
    • Roasted peanuts
    • Green onions
    • Jalapeno

    Dressing:

    • Olive oil
    • Sesame oil
    • Lime juice
    • Ginger
    • Soy sauce
    • Honey
    • White vinegar
    • Water

    Instructions

    Mixing ingredients for chopped salad.

    In a large bowl, mix together all salad ingredients.

    Mixing sesame ginger lime dressing.

    To make the dressing, whisk together all dressing ingredients in a medium sized bowl or measuring cup. Pour the dressing over the salad and toss to coat.

    Tossing thai chopped salad and adding green onion, peanuts and cilantro.

    Once the salad is thoroughly coated in the dressing, sprinkle with optional toppings such as cilantro, roasted peanuts, green onions and jalapeno!

    Substitutions and Variations

    To make gluten-free: Use certified gluten-free tamari or coconut aminos instead of soy sauce in the dressing.

    To make vegan: Swap honey for maple syrup in the dressing.

    To make nut-free: Swap peanuts for roasted sunflower seeds or tortilla strip to keep the crunch factor.

    Storage

    This is the perfect meal prep salad! Store it in an airtight container in the fridge for up to 5 days.

    Equipment

    • Mixing bowl
    • Food processor (handy for shredding cabbage and carrots)
    • Salad chopper (optional)

    Top Tip

    I already hinted to this earlier, but this Thai chopped salad tastes even better if you make it ahead of time and let it sit for a couple hours. Unlike most salads that get soggy, thanks to the use of cabbage and kale as the base, it won’t get soggy and will absorb more of the flavour of the dressing.

    Frequently Asked Questions

    Can I eat this Thai chopped salad for a meal?

    Yes! The great thing about this salad is it’s the perfect balance of vegetables (for fibre, fullness and vitamins), quinoa (for carbohydrates) and edamame (for protein). Plus, the dressing contains healthy fats! This is truly the PERFECT balanced salad to satisfy your hunger and provide lasting energy to power you through your day.

    What are some other ways I can enjoy this salad? 

    As much as I love eating this salad on it’s own, it also is such a great addition to a wrap! Simply add a large serving spoonful of salad into the center of a tortilla and wrap it up with other fillings of choice.

    It also works great as a dip. As all the components are chopped thinly, you can serve it with some low-sodium tortilla chips for the perfect refreshing summer snack!

    Can I add another protein source?

    Yes of course! Grilled/crispy chicken or even steak would make an amazing addition to this salad.

    Eating a bowl of Thai chopped salad.

    More Yummy Salad Recipes

    Are you a big salad fan? Give these recipes a try:

    • Santa Fe Salad
    • Tahini Kale Salad
    • Easy Chopped Dill Pickle Salad
    • Copycat Costco Quinoa Salad

    PS. I love seeing my recipes in action! If you decide to make this Thai chopped salad, don't forget to snap a photo and tag me on Instagram- @nourishedbynic or leave a comment and rating below letting me know how you liked it!

    📖 Recipe

    Thai chopped salad in a bowl.
    Print Recipe Pin Recipe
    5 from 19 votes

    Thai Chopped Salad (Meal Prep Friendly)

    Packed with colorful veggies and a tangy sesame ginger lime dressing, this Thai chopped salad is the best balanced recipe that's also meal prep friendly!
    Prep Time30 minutes mins
    Total Time30 minutes mins
    Course: Appetizer, Main Course, Salad, Side Dish
    Cuisine: Thai
    Keyword: 30 minute meals, meal prep, salads, vegetables
    Servings: 5 servings

    Ingredients 

    Salad Base

    • 1 cup white quinoa cooked according to package instructions
    • 2 cups defrosted frozen edamame beans
    • 2 cups purple cabbage shredded (about ½ a medium head of cabbage)
    • 2 cups carrots shredded
    • 1 cup curly kale chopped (stems removed)
    • 1 cup cucumber diced

    Optional Toppers

    • ¼ cup cilantro chopped
    • ½ cup roasted peanuts chopped
    • ⅓ cup diced green onions
    • 1 tablespoon jalapeno diced

    Sesame Ginger Lime Dressing

    • ¼ cup olive oil
    • 1 tablespoon sesame oil
    • Juice of ½ a lime about 1 tbsp
    • 1 inch of fresh ginger grated
    • 3 tablespoon low sodium soy sauce
    • 2 tablespoon water
    • 1 tablespoon honey
    • 2 tablespoon white vinegar

    Instructions

    • In a large bowl, mix together all salad ingredients.
    • To make the dressing, whisk together all dressing ingredients in a medium sized bowl. Pour the dressing over the salad and toss to coat.
    • Once the salad is thoroughly coated in the dressing, sprinkle with optional toppers such as cilantro, roasted peanuts, green onions and jalapeno!

    Notes

    *I have included the nutrition information for this recipe above. However, always remember a recipe is so much more than just nutritional content and these numbers do not need to dictate your food choices. Please don't forget both your body and soul need nourishment!

    Nutrition

    Serving: 2cups | Calories: 462kcal | Carbohydrates: 46g | Protein: 17g | Fat: 25g | Saturated Fat: 3g | Polyunsaturated Fat: 6g | Monounsaturated Fat: 13g | Sodium: 461mg | Potassium: 945mg | Fiber: 9g | Sugar: 10g | Vitamin A: 9547IU | Vitamin C: 33mg | Calcium: 136mg | Iron: 4mg
    Did you know....rating and sharing recipes is one of the best ways you can support your favourite food bloggers? If you make this recipe, I would love if you clicked the stars below to leave a rating and/or sharing a photo on social media by tagging @nourishedbynic or using the hashtag #nourishedbynic!

    More Salads

    • Bowl of tuna pasta salad without mayo.
      Tuna Pasta Salad Without Mayo
    • Close up of a bowl with BLT pasta salad.
      Bowtie BLT Pasta Salad
    • Close up of broccoli coleslaw salad.
      Crunchy Broccoli Coleslaw Salad
    • Birds eye of a bowl of dill pickle pasta salad.
      Dill Pickle Pasta Salad

    Share this recipe!

    • Facebook

    Comments

      Leave a Reply Cancel reply

      Your email address will not be published. Required fields are marked *

      Recipe Rating




    1. Mel says

      March 23, 2025 at 7:41 pm

      5 stars
      This salad is delicious!! I made it for a potluck at work and 5 of my coworkers requested the recipe!! Everyone loved it.

      Reply
    2. Dan says

      March 23, 2025 at 3:10 am

      Wait if 8 cups makes 4 serves. And this recipe calls for 125ml of olive oil, that’s actually 30ml of olive oil per serve. Which equals 240 calories from 28g of fat PER SERVE. WOW. I don’t think ppl realise this isn’t the “healthy” recipe option they think it is. Also pretty deceptive to put it in “cups” and then do nutritional info on “cups” when it should be per serve (which you’ve stated is around 2 cups)

      Reply
      • Nicole Addison says

        March 23, 2025 at 1:42 pm

        Hi there Dan,

        There is only 1/4 cup of olive oil which equates to 60mL! The nutritional information provided is per two cups (serving) so you do not need to double any calculations and no deceptiveness here- to make it easier I have also changed the yield value to the amount of total servings so I appreciate the feedback!

        Reply
    3. Jackie says

      March 20, 2025 at 1:28 am

      5 stars
      Loved this recipe! The dressing is delicious and it came together so easily. Paired it with the ginger chicken meatballs and it was so good.

      Reply
    4. Lisa says

      January 13, 2025 at 12:50 pm

      I love this recipe but I would leave out the word “dry” for the quinoa. I got confused and thought it meant 1 cup of dry quinoa instead of cooked because it’s saying 2 opposing things at the same time. I’ve only ever tried it with a mountain of quinoa. Today I’ll try it with less as intended

      Reply
      • Nicole Addison says

        January 13, 2025 at 5:36 pm

        Hi Lisa! thank you for the feedback, it's always good to hear how someone else may have been interpreting something!

        Reply
    5. Wendy Bell says

      November 30, 2024 at 9:40 am

      5 stars
      OMG this salad is delicious!
      Mike drop !

      Reply
    « Older Comments
    Newer Comments »
    Nicole Addison, RD

    Hi I'm Nicole!

    I’m a Registered Dietitian, recipe developer and content creator on a mission to help individuals rediscover the joys of cooking with easy, accessible, healthy recipes.

    On my page you'll find yummy recipes, wellness tips, and even some of my favourite travel and lifestyle recommendations!

    More about me →

    Popular

    • peanut butter energy balls feature photo
      Crunchy Peanut Butter Energy Balls
    • Glass of homemade watermelon electrolyte drink.
      Homemade Electrolyte Drink Recipe
    • A chocolate and zucchini muffin cut in half.
      Chocolate and Zucchini Brownie Muffins
    • baked chicken orzo
      One Pan Zucchini and Lemon Baked Chicken Orzo

    Sweet Treats We're Loving

    • Chocolate peanut butter frozen yogurt bites stacked.
      Double Chocolate Frozen Yogurt Bites
    • Close up of a strawberry fruit popsicle swirled with greek yogurt.
      Strawberry Fruit Popsicles with Greek Yogurt
    • Close up of a strawberry cheesecake cup with whipped cream.
      Strawberry Cheesecake Cups with Cottage Cheese
    • A banana oatmeal chocolate chip cookie split in half and stacked.
      Banana and Chocolate Chip Cookies

    Footer

    ↑ back to top

    About

    • Privacy Policy

    Newsletter

    • Sign Up! for emails and updates

    Contact

    • Contact
    • Services

    As an Amazon Associate I earn from qualifying purchases.

    Copyright © 2025 Nourished by Nic

    2.6K shares